Typical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(small-scale water filtration system)
$3,500 - $7,500 (whole-house water treatment installation)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Water Softening System | $1,200 - $2,500 |
| Reverse Osmosis System | $1,800 - $3,500 |
| UV Water Disinfection |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Whole-House Filtration | $3,500 - $7,500 |
| Water Softener Replacement |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| Custom Water Treatment System | $4,000 - $10,000 |
Factors Influencing Cost
Water treatment services in Garner, NC, encompass a range of solutions to improve water quality for residential and commercial properties. These projects can vary based on the scope of work, materials used, and site-specific requirements. Understanding typical project considerations can help in planning and comparing options for water treatment needs.
- Materials: Common materials include carbon filters, reverse osmosis membranes, UV sterilizers, and water softening media, selected based on water quality and treatment goals.
- Size and Scope: Projects may range from small point-of-use systems for individual appliances to large-scale whole-house treatment setups, depending on water volume and contamination levels.
- Labor Complexity: Installation complexity varies with system type, existing plumbing configuration, and site access, influencing overall labor requirements.
- Permitting: Some water treatment installations in Garner, NC, may require permits or inspections, especially for larger systems or those involving plumbing modifications.
- Extras: Additional options can include water testing, system upgrades, maintenance packages, and filtration system accessories to enhance performance and longevity.
